New tourism campaign for Australia
Tourism Australia has launched a new advertising campaign to replace the controversial ‘Where the bloody hell are you?’ campaign, The Telegraph has reported.
The tagline ‘There’s nothing like Australia’ will accompany the $150 million campaign, and Australians are being encouraged to take part by submitting photographs and descriptions of their favourite destinations.
Tourism Australia managing director Andrew McEvoy commented, “The catchphrase is true, it’s authentic and we hope it will burn brightly for ten years.”
Although criticised by some for being bland and boring, the new campaign is regarded as a far safer option than its predecessor.
The notorious ‘bloody hell’ advertisements featured bikini-clad models, and caused confusion in many non-English speaking countries, as well as being banned in Canada and Britain.
